Mosquito Forecast for Flam Railway

When planning a visit to the scenic Flam Railway in Norway, it's wise to consider the local mosquito forecast. Mosquito activity here peaks in summer months, with July and June seeing the highest numbers, rated 9 and 8 respectively on a 1-10 scale. Spring and early autumn bring moderate mosquito presence, while winter months are virtually mosquito-free. This Flam Railway mosquito forecast helps travelers prepare for the best times to enjoy the breathtaking fjord views without too many pesky insects. What Influences Mosquito Activity Around Flam Railway?

Several factors affect mosquito populations near Flam Railway, including climate, geography, and local water bodies. The region's fjords and rivers create ideal breeding grounds for mosquitoes during warmer months. Additionally, the area's mild summers and increased rainfall contribute to higher mosquito activity. Visitors should note: - Mosquitoes thrive in humid conditions - Standing water near hiking trails can be breeding sites Understanding these influences helps travelers anticipate mosquito presence. For example, taking a boat ride on the Aurlandsfjord might expose you to fewer mosquitoes than hiking through the lush forests nearby. Mosquito-Borne Diseases in the Flam Railway Area

While mosquitoes are common around Flam Railway, the risk of mosquito-borne diseases is relatively low compared to other regions. Norway generally reports minimal cases of illnesses like West Nile virus or malaria. However, it's still important to be cautious, especially during peak mosquito months. Protecting yourself reduces the chance of bites and potential infections. Key points to remember: 1. Use insect repellent when outdoors 2. Wear long sleeves and pants at dusk 3.
